Essential Equipment for Year-Round Outdoor Cinema

Successful outdoor cinema requires reliable, quality equipment regardless of season. Core requirements include:

  • Bright projector: At least 3000 lumens to overcome ambient light and outdoor conditions
  • Durable screens: Built to withstand weather exposure throughout the year
  • Quality sound systems: Outdoor-rated speakers that project clearly to all attendees
  • Reliable media players: Functioning in various temperature and humidity conditions
  • Adequate power sources: Safe, protected electrical infrastructure
  • Weather protection: Tarps, tents, and structures to shield equipment and attendees

Investing in quality equipment that functions reliably across seasons pays dividends throughout the year.

Summer Outdoor Cinema: Maximizing Long Daylight Hours

Summer offers the longest daylight hours, requiring strategic timing for movie screenings:

Timing Considerations

Summer dates require later start times to ensure full darkness during film projection. In most regions, this means starting films between 8:30-9:00 PM. Starting earlier risks inadequate darkness and image washout.

Heat and Cooling Management

Summer heat demands proactive comfort measures:

  • Shade structures: Large umbrellas, canopies, or tents for protection from sun before the movie
  • Cooling stations: Fans, misters, or air conditioning units in key areas
  • Hydration focus: Abundant water and beverages throughout the event
  • Light clothing encouragement: Communicate expectations about informal dress
  • Ice and cold refreshments: Popsicles, iced drinks, and cold snacks

Insect Management

Mosquitoes and other insects increase in summer. Manage them through:

  • Citronella candles and mosquito repellent diffusers
  • Encouraging attendees to bring insect repellent
  • Identifying and reducing standing water where insects breed
  • Timing events when insects are less active

Summer Atmosphere and Content

Summer content and atmosphere should celebrate the season:

  • Film selection: Action movies, comedies, family-friendly features, or classic summer blockbusters
  • Pre-show activities: Lawn games, picnicking, social mingling
  • Decorative elements: String lights, patriotic décor (if timing aligns), outdoor furniture
  • Food themes: Grilling, BBQ, fresh salads, seasonal fruits

Fall/Autumn Outdoor Cinema: Creating Cozy Atmosphere

Autumn brings moderate temperatures and earlier darkness, ideal for outdoor cinema with distinctive atmosphere options:

Timing and Darkness

Fall's earlier sunsets mean outdoor movies can begin as early as 7:00-8:00 PM, expanding scheduling flexibility.

Autumn Comfort Elements

Create cozy, fall-themed environments:

  • Blankets and cushions: Allow attendees to nest comfortably as temperatures drop
  • Warm beverages: Coffee, hot cider, hot chocolate, and tea
  • Pumpkin décor: Pumpkins, hay bales, corn stalks, autumn leaf arrangements
  • String lighting: Creates warm, inviting ambiance during dimmer fall evenings
  • Fire pits or heaters: Provide warmth and create gathering spots

Autumn Atmosphere and Content

Leverage fall characteristics for atmosphere:

  • Film selection: Horror/thriller films resonate particularly well in autumn; also consider feel-good movies and family features
  • Pre-show activities: Pumpkin carving, costume contests, craft stations
  • Food themes: Apple treats, pumpkin-based foods, warm comfort foods
  • Seasonal celebrations: Halloween-themed events if timing aligns

Winter Outdoor Cinema: Embracing Cold-Weather Entertainment

Winter offers unique opportunities for distinctive outdoor movie experiences:

Cold-Weather Shelter

Winter events require substantial weather protection:

  • Large tent or temporary structures: Protects attendees from wind, snow, and sleet
  • Heated spaces: Outdoor heaters, heat lamps, or heated tents
  • Wind barriers: Protects from cold wind gusts
  • Snow management: Clear pathways and seating areas regularly

Winter Warmth and Comfort

Thermal comfort becomes essential:

  • Heated seating: Heated chairs, blankets, and thermal accessories
  • Warm food service: Hot soups, stews, warm pastries, and comfort foods
  • Hot beverages: Coffee, hot chocolate, mulled wine, and specialty warm drinks
  • Protective clothing encouragement: Communicate expectations about warm attire

Winter Atmosphere and Content

Winter offers distinctive atmosphere opportunities:

  • Film selection: Holiday classics, feel-good movies, family features, or cozy dramas
  • Holiday décor: Lights, decorations, snow elements (natural or added)
  • Special events: Holiday-themed screenings, winter celebrations
  • Community building: Winter events often attract dedicated supporters and create strong community connection

Spring Outdoor Cinema: Renewal and Fresh Starts

Spring's moderate temperatures and rapidly increasing daylight hours offer opportunities for outdoor cinema with specific considerations:

Spring Timing and Weather Variability

Spring weather is notoriously unpredictable. Account for this variability in planning:

  • Build weather contingencies into spring events
  • Have flexible scheduling options for date changes
  • Maintain protective structures for unexpected rain or cold

Spring Atmosphere

Capitalize on spring's renewal themes:

  • Film selection: Romantic comedies, family-friendly films, adventure movies
  • Decorative elements: Fresh flowers, spring greenery, light colors
  • Food themes: Fresh salads, spring vegetables, lighter fare
  • Activity focus: Outdoor games, picnicking, nature-based pre-show activities

Frequently Asked Questions About Seasonal Outdoor Cinema

Can you really host outdoor movie events in winter?

Absolutely! With proper shelter, heating, and weather protection, winter events are not only possible but can create distinctive, memorable experiences. The coziness and comfort elements of winter cinema are unmatched.

What's the best season for outdoor cinema?

Each season has advantages. Summer offers long daylight hours, fall provides perfect temperatures and cozy atmosphere, winter creates distinctive experiences, and spring celebrates renewal. The "best" season depends on your climate, audience, and specific goals.

How much do seasonal adaptations increase event costs?

Cost increases depend on the level of comfort amenities you provide. Basic seasonal adaptations (blankets, heaters, appropriate food) have minimal cost impact. Professional-level weather protection and heating systems increase costs more significantly.

What equipment fails most often in different seasons?

Equipment challenges vary: summer heat can affect projector cooling, winter cold impacts battery performance and power systems, spring moisture affects electronics, and fall wind can impact structure stability. Quality, outdoor-rated equipment minimizes seasonal failures.
